航芯ACM32F403_A403_FP401_F070_A070_WB15系列芯片GPIO应用笔记.pdfVIP

航芯ACM32F403_A403_FP401_F070_A070_WB15系列芯片GPIO应用笔记.pdf

  1. 1、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。。
  2. 2、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  3. 3、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
  4. 4、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
  5. 5、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们
  6. 6、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
  7. 7、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
查看更多

航芯科技(www.HangC)ACM32F403/A403/FP401/F070/A070/WB15系列芯片GPIO应用笔记

应用笔记

ACM32F403/A403/FP401/F070/A070/WB15系列芯片

GPIO应用笔记

版本:V1.2

日期:2025-3-10

上海航芯电子科技股份有限公司

版本:V1.21/5

航芯科技(www.HangC)ACM32F403/A403/FP401/F070/A070/WB15系列芯片GPIO应用笔记

1.系统寄存器中与GPIO相关寄存器综述

与GPIO相关的寄存器分为两部分,一部分在SCU系统寄存器中,另一部分在GPIO寄存器中。ACM32F4xx

系列芯片的GPIO由GPIO1、GPIO2、GPIO3组成,如下表所示。

GPIO1GPIO2GPIO3

PA0~PA15PB0~PB15PC0~PC15PD0~PD15PE0~PE15PF0~PF3

下面以GPIO1为例子,说明与GPIO相关寄存器的配置。

1.1.复用功能配置

通过配置系统寄存器(SCU)中的PASEL1、PASEL2来选择PA0~PA15管脚的复用功能。

通过配置系统寄存器(SCU)中的PBSEL1、PBSEL2来选择PB0~PB15管脚的复用功能。

1.2.管脚上下拉配置

通过配置系统寄存器(SCU)中的PA/BPUR、PA/BPDR来配置PA0~PA15、PB0~PB15管脚的上下拉电阻。

1.3.管脚驱动能力配置

通过配置系统寄存器(SCU)中的PASTR、PBSTR来配置相应管脚的驱动能力。

1.4.施密特功能配置

通过配置系统寄存器(SCU)中的PA/BSMTR来使能或禁止相应管脚的施密特功能。

1.5.开漏配置

通过配置系统寄存器(SCU)中的PA/BODR来来使能或禁止相应管脚的开漏功能。

1.6.管脚数字/模拟选择

通过配置系统寄存器(SCU)中的PA/BADS来选择管脚是数字功能或模拟功能。

注:在复位后,除Wakeup唤醒引脚、Debug调试引脚、MCO功能引脚为数字模式。大部分GPIO配置为模

拟模式(数字功能失效,上下拉电阻失效)。

版本:V1.22/5

航芯科技(www.HangC)ACM32F403/A403/FP401/F070/A070/WB15系列芯片GPIO应用笔记

2.GPIO模块中寄存器功能描述

此部分寄存器在GPIO自身模块中,具体包含内容如下表所示。

数据方向寄存器GPIO_DIR

输出置位寄存器GPIO_SET

输出清零寄存器GPIO_CLR

输出引脚映射寄存器GPIO_ODATA

输入引脚映射寄存器GPIO_IDATA

中断使能寄存器GPIO_IEN

中断触发模式寄存器GPIO_IS

中断触发模式寄存器GPIO_IBE

中断触发模式寄存器GPIO_IEV

中断状态清除寄存器GPIO_IC

原始中断状态寄存器GPIO_RIS

屏蔽后中断状态寄存器GPIO_MIS

2.1.GPIO输入输出

通过设置DIR寄存来选择GPIO输入、输出。

选择输出功能时,可以使用SET、CLR两个寄存器或者ODATA一个寄存器来控制输出状态。

选择输

文档评论(0)

说明书资料库 + 关注
实名认证
服务提供商

专注于工业自动化资料查找服务。

1亿VIP精品文档

相关文档